HomeSort by relevance Sort by last modified time
    Searched refs:SkBaseMutex (Results 1 - 12 of 12) sorted by null

  /external/skia/include/core/
SkThread_platform.h 60 // A SkBaseMutex is a POD structure that can be directly initialized
65 struct SkBaseMutex {
73 #define SK_DECLARE_STATIC_MUTEX(name) static SkBaseMutex name = { PTHREAD_MUTEX_INITIALIZER }
76 #define SK_DECLARE_GLOBAL_MUTEX(name) SkBaseMutex name = { PTHREAD_MUTEX_INITIALIZER }
78 #define SK_DECLARE_MUTEX_ARRAY(name, count) SkBaseMutex name[count] = { PTHREAD_MUTEX_INITIALIZER }
82 class SkMutex : public SkBaseMutex, SkNoncopyable {
90 // In the generic case, SkBaseMutex and SkMutex are the same thing, and we
109 typedef SkMutex SkBaseMutex;
111 #define SK_DECLARE_STATIC_MUTEX(name) static SkBaseMutex name
112 #define SK_DECLARE_GLOBAL_MUTEX(name) SkBaseMutex nam
    [all...]
SkThread.h 34 explicit SkAutoMutexAcquire(SkBaseMutex& mutex) : fMutex(&mutex)
58 SkBaseMutex* fMutex;
SkPixelRef.h 55 explicit SkPixelRef(SkBaseMutex* mutex = NULL);
205 SkBaseMutex* mutex() const { return fMutex; }
207 SkPixelRef(SkFlattenableReadBuffer&, SkBaseMutex*);
226 SkBaseMutex* fMutex; // must remain in scope for the life of this object
240 void setMutex(SkBaseMutex* mutex);
  /external/skia/include/pdf/
SkPDFShader.h 59 static SkBaseMutex& CanonicalShadersMutex();
SkPDFGraphicState.h 89 static SkBaseMutex& CanonicalPaintsMutex();
SkPDFFont.h 199 static SkBaseMutex& CanonicalFontsMutex();
  /external/skia/src/core/
SkPixelRef.cpp 22 SkBaseMutex* get_default_mutex() {
49 void SkPixelRef::setMutex(SkBaseMutex* mutex) {
59 SkPixelRef::SkPixelRef(SkBaseMutex* mutex) : fPreLocked(false) {
69 SkPixelRef::SkPixelRef(SkFlattenableReadBuffer& buffer, SkBaseMutex* mutex) {
SkMemory_stdlib.cpp 32 static SkBaseMutex& get_block_mutex() {
  /external/skia/src/images/
SkImageRef_GlobalPool.cpp 12 extern SkBaseMutex gImageRefMutex;
  /external/skia/src/pdf/
SkPDFGraphicState.cpp 88 SkBaseMutex& SkPDFGraphicState::CanonicalPaintsMutex() {
SkPDFShader.cpp 394 SkBaseMutex& SkPDFShader::CanonicalShadersMutex() {
SkPDFFont.cpp 800 SkBaseMutex& SkPDFFont::CanonicalFontsMutex() {
    [all...]

Completed in 91 milliseconds